The aim of this study is to assess whether pupillary modifications following ocular anticholinergic and cholinergic drugs can identify subjects with neurodegenerative diseases from early stages.
51 subjects were divided into 3 groups, according to different neurodegenerative diseases, and compared with a control group of 10 patients. Pupil diameter has been measured at different times after topical administration of tropicamide 0.01% in the right eye. Then, topical administration of pilocarpine 0.06% has been performed, followed by pupillary constriction measurement. Pupillary response rates were stratified according to acetylcholinesterase inhibitors intake.
Observed mydriasis and pupillary constriction was similar in all study groups at all evaluation times. Patients without acetylcholinesterase inhibitors intake presented greater mydriasis.
Although it was not possible to observe significant differences among groups in terms of pupillary response, the analysis of pupillary features may become an useful tool to detect efficacy of acetylcholinesterase inhibitors.

A 68-year-old female was admitted to the ER due to dysphagia and a cough. The patient had a medical history of TEF resulting from a tracheostomy and prolonged mechanical ventilation. Previous endoscopic treatment had failed, namely 3-attempts of closure with an over-the-scope clip (OTSC®). The patient refused surgery. After a multidisciplinary discussion (Gastroenterology, Pneumology, Surgery and Interventional-Cardiology), we decided to attempt Amplatzer-Occluder® placement. An 8mm Amplatzer-Occluder® was placed from the tracheal side, with sequential opening of the esophageal and tracheal strands (under endoscopic, bronchofibroscopic and fluoroscopic visualization). Nevertheless, migration of the device occurred 8-weeks later. Percutaneous endoscopic gastrostomy (PEG) was placed and the patient was referred to surgery. When there is extensive fibrosis that is not amendable to the application of clips, atrial septal defect occluder devices can be considered to manage TEF. Nevertheless, there is a need to develop strategies to minimize migration risk.
the present study aimed to describe the characteristics of articles that had the most citations in the field of digestive endoscopy.
articles included were obtained from the Web of Science database, which were selected and ranked according to the number of citations. The characteristics of the 100 most cited articles were then analyzed.
the number of citations of the top 100 of 303,063 eligible papers ranged from 370 to 2,866. The most cited paper was a study of colorectal cancer prevention using colonoscopic polypectomy. The most common topics discussed by the top 100 papers included colonoscopy (n = 33) and upper gastrointestinal endoscopy (n = 23), with most of the papers focusing on diagnosis (n = 24) and treatment (n = 15).
by identifying the most influential publications, the present study could serve as a guide toward further development in the area of digestive endoscopy.

Spermatozoa are synthesized in the testes inactively with a thick glycocalyx and passed through the epididymis for further modification by glycosylation, deglycosylation, and integration to reach maturation. Subsequently, sperm capacitation and further fertilization require redistribution of glycoconjugates and dramatic glycocalyx modification of the spermatozoa surface. Furthermore, glycoproteins and glycans in seminal plasma are functional in maintaining spermatozoa structure and stability. Therefore, aberrant glycosylation may cause alteration of semen function and even infertility. Currently, mass spectrometry-based technologies have allowed large-scale profiling of glycans and glycoproteins in human semen. Quantitative analysis of semen glycosylation has also indicated many involved glycoproteome issues in male infertility and the potential biomarkers for diagnosis of male infertility in clinical. Globally, these factors vary across time and space. The persistence of viral pathogens, and ultimately their ecology and dispersion, hinges on their ability to withstand the environmental conditions encountered. To understand how virus populations evolve under changing environmental conditions, we experimentally adapted echovirus 11 (E11) to four climate regimes. #link# Specifically, we incubated E11 in lake water at 10 and 30 °C and in the presence and absence of sunlight. Temperature was the main driver of adaptation, resulting in an increased thermotolerance of the 30 °C adapted populations, whereas the 10 °C adapted strains were rapidly inactivated at higher temperatures. This finding is consistent with a source-sink model in which strains emerging in warm climates can persist in temperate regions, but not vice versa. A microbial risk assessment revealed that the enhanced thermotolerance increases the length of time in which there is an elevated probability of illness associated with swimming in contaminated water.
